“Great location”
The location of this hotel cannot be beat! We could see the harbor even out of our promo room. The hotel is next to Galleries Lafayette and central street and the harbor. There are many restaraunts around. Our room was large. The staff at the front desk was great, with good English! Howerver, we had 3 concerns about the room: the heater did not work (we realized it too late so we did not bring it up to the staff), the carpet was very old and the oddest thing is that the shower tub did not have a curtain - huge inconvenience; besides the feeling that you are on a stage, the water was all over the floor and everything that was laying around the bathroom and the toilet (we started to put the lid and the seat up before taking a shower). It was impossible not to have water on the bathroom floor. We had to request extra towels every day to wipe the floor. Hotel management, please, put shower curtains!

“Good unpretentious hotel for the budget minded.”
Location is perfectly safe. It's only few steps to the metro station, Rue Canabriere and Vieux Port area where there are many shops and restaurants, and where you can take the Petite Train for sightseeing. Tourist Office and money changer are nearby. Room, elevator and reception area are small but more than adequate. Front desk ladies were cheerful, very nice and hepful. We'll stay at this hotel again. Highly recommended for frugal travellers!!
“Very happy with our stay”
The hotel... was as most previous reviews mentioned and there were no surprises. The hardest thing was finding the place with Gps in our hire care as the address does not take you to the small street where you can park the car while unloading your luggage. True to their word the Supermarket carpark across the street was a good place to park the car when not in use. The staff were friendly and I will certainly stay here again should I return to Marseille.
